Key Architectural Decisions
- Authorization Engine --- Stateless EJB computing effective permissions at runtime via recursive hierarchy traversal → union of all permissions → DENY overrides GRANT →
session-scoped cache
-
Data Security --- EJB interceptor pattern injecting WHERE clause conditions from user's effective data security policies
-
Menu = Resources --- sec_resources with resource_type='MENU' and parent self-reference serves as both navigation tree and function security targets
-
Aggregate Privilege --- A role record that links to exactly 1 permission + 1 data security policy, always predefined, never inheritable
Role Hierarchy Rules
-
Job/Abstract roles inherit from Duty roles and Aggregate Privileges
-
Duty roles inherit from other Duty roles and Aggregate Privileges
-
Aggregate Privileges inherit from nothing
-
Users are only directly assigned Job Roles and Abstract Roles
-
Predefined roles (code starting with OB_) are not editable
